Crispy Loaded Potato Taco Bowl

Crispy Loaded Potato Taco Bowl: Comfort in Every Bite

Enjoy the Crispy Loaded Potato Taco Bowl, a delightful fusion of comforting flavors and crispy textures perfect for dinner.

Servings: 4 bowls
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: Tex-Mex
Calories: 550

Ingredients
  

Base
  • 4 large Russet Potatoes chopped into 1-inch chunks
  • 1 cup Water
Protein
  • 1 pound Ground Beef can substitute with turkey or chicken
  • 1 cup Frozen Corn can substitute with fresh corn
Seasoning
  • 2 tablespoons Chili Powder adjust to taste
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on Pepper
Toppings
  • 1 cup Shredded Cheddar can substitute with Monterey Jack or Mexican cheese blend
  • 1 cup Guacamole can substitute with avocado
  • 1 cup Pico de Gallo or preferred salsa variety
  • 1/2 cup Sour Cream or Chipotle Crema can substitute with Greek yogurt

Equipment

  • Oven
  • Large Skillet
  • Baking Sheet
  • Mixing bowl

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Wash, peel, and chop russet potatoes into 1-inch chunks. Soak in cold water for 20-30 minutes, then drain and dry thoroughly.
  2. Toss dried potatoes with oil, half of the chili powder, and a pinch of salt. Spread on a baking sheet and roast for 20-25 minutes, turning halfway through until golden brown and crispy.
Cooking
  1. In a skillet over medium-high heat, add remaining chili powder, garlic powder, salt, and pepper; toast for 30 seconds until fragrant.
  2. Add ground beef, breaking it apart, and cook for 5-7 minutes until browned.
  3. Stir in frozen corn and pour in water; simmer for about 5 minutes until heated through.
Assembly
  1. Layer roasted potatoes in bowls, spoon the beef and corn mixture over, and top with shredded cheddar, guacamole, pico de gallo, and sour cream.

Notes

Store leftover components separately to keep potatoes crispy; consume within 4 days for best quality.
